Abstract

An electrical cable holder has a holder body having a fixing device (for example, anchor part) and a fastening part positioned beneath the fixing device (for example, anchor part) for provisionally placing an electrical cable (for example, power transmission cable); and a movable arm movably supported on the holder body for fastening the electrical cable (for example, power transmission cable) provisionally placed in the fastening part, between the movable arm and the fastening part. A lock device for locking the movable arm in a fastening state, in which the electrical cable (for example, power transmission cable) is fastened by the fastening part, is provided between the movable arm and the fastening part. A stationary device for maintaining a non-fastening state is provided between the holder body and the movable arm.

What is claimed is: 
     
       1. An electrical cable holder for fixing an electrical cable on an attachment-receiving-object, comprising:
 a holder body having a fixing device for fixing to the attachment-receiving object, a fastening part extending downwardly from one end portion thereof to form a C-shaped arc and positioned below the fixing device for placing the electrical cable thereinside, a free end of the C-shaped arc being arranged below another end portion of the holder body to maintain a gap therebetween for inserting the electrical cable therethrough, and including one of a shaft part or a shaft hole; and 
 a movable arm including another of the shaft hole or the shaft part engaging the one of the shaft part or the shaft hole of the holder body to be movably supported on the holder body for fastening the electrical cable placed in the fastening part, between the movable arm and the fastening part, 
 wherein a lock device for locking the movable arm in a fastening state where the electrical cable is fixed on the fastening part, is provided between the movable arm and the fastening part; 
 a stationary device for maintaining a non-fastening state is provided between the holder body and the movable arm; 
 the holder body includes an arm support part formed on the another end portion thereof and having a pair of support arms apart from each other to form an interval therebetween, and the movable arm includes a neck part having a width equal to or greater than the interval between the pair of support arms; and 
 the pair of support arms and the neck part form the stationary device, and the neck part is held inside the interval between the pair of support arms so that the movable arm is frictionally retained at a position away from the fastening part. 
 
     
     
       2. A combination comprising:
 the electrical cable holder according to  claim 1 , and 
 the attachment-receiving object, 
 wherein the attachment-receiving object is provided with an attachment hole for fixing the fixing device; and 
 the fixing device includes an attachment member accommodated in the attachment hole. 
 
     
     
       3. The electrical cable holder according to  claim 1 , wherein the shaft part and the shaft hole contact closely to each other in the fastening state. 
     
     
       4. The electrical cable holder according to  claim 1 , wherein the holder body includes the shaft hole at the another end portion thereof, and the movable arm includes the shaft part at one end portion thereof; and
 the neck part has a reduced width at the movable arm and arranged adjacent to the shaft part, and the pair of support arms protrudes outwardly in a direction opposite to the fixed device. 
 
     
     
       5. The electrical cable holder according to  claim 4 , wherein the fastening part includes a ratchet having a plurality of tooth portions protruding from an outer surface thereof and arranged apart from each other along an outer perimeter thereof, and the movable arm includes a lock part formed at another end portion thereof and having a lock claw protruding outwardly to engage one of the plurality of tooth portions; and the ratchet of the fastening part and the lock claw form the lock device. 
     
     
       6. The electrical cable holder according to  claim 5 , wherein the fastening part includes a guide rib protruding outwardly from the outer surface thereof and formed on a center portion in a width direction thereof to bisect the plurality of tooth portions in the width direction, and the guide rib includes tapered faces formed at two side portions thereof and tapered in a direction away from the outer surface of the fastening part; and the lock part includes release arms connecting the lock claw and extending outwardly in a width direction of the movable arm such that the release arms contact the tapered faces to detach the lock claw from the one of the plurality of tooth portions. 
     
     
       7. A combination comprising:
 an electrical cable holder for fixing to an attachment-receiving object an electrical cable wired between stationary objects arranged above a structural object with a space therebetween, comprising:
 a holder body having a fixing device for fixing to the stationary object, and a fastening part positioned below the fixing device for placing the electrical cable; and 
 a movable arm supported rotatably on the holder body, for fastening the electrical cable provisionally placed in the fastening part, between the movable arm and the fastening part, 
 wherein a lock device for locking the movable arm in a fastening state, in which the electrical cable is fastened on the fastening part, is provided between the movable arm and the fastening part, and the lock device includes a ratchet formed along an outer perimeter at a lower side thereof and having a plurality of tooth portions, a lock claw bent toward the ratchet to engage one of the plurality of tooth portions of the ratchet, and a release arm connecting the lock claw; 
 the lock claw is bent from an end of the release arm; and 
 the movable arm is arranged to rotate to maintain a gap with the structural object in a state in which the movable arm is most proximal to the structural object; 
 
 the structural object and the stationary objects arranged above and spaced from the structural object, 
 wherein the structural object is a roof member; and 
 the stationary object is a solar panel or a mount for attaching the solar panel.
